
漂亮的E4A界面自动更新类库及教程
5星
- 浏览量: 0
- 大小:None
- 文件类型:RAR
简介:
本项目提供一套用于E4A(易语言)开发环境下的漂亮界面自动更新类库,配套详细教程帮助开发者轻松实现应用界面的动态更新与美化。
E4A(Easy4App)是一款专为移动应用开发者设计的编程工具,它采用简单的语法,使得非专业程序员也能快速构建安卓应用。本教程聚焦于E4A中的一个关键组件——“自动更新类库”,这是一个能够帮助开发者轻松实现应用内自动更新功能的库。这个类库不仅提升了应用的用户体验,还能确保用户始终使用的是最新、最安全的软件版本。
自动更新类库在E4A中的运用涉及多个知识点:
1. **网络通信**:自动更新功能需要与服务器进行交互,获取最新的应用版本信息。这通常通过HTTP或HTTPS协议实现,可以使用E4A内置的网络模块来发送GET或POST请求,从而从服务器上下载更新文件。
2. **文件下载管理**:当检测到新版本时,需要下载更新包。E4A提供了文件操作接口,可以帮助开发者监控、暂停和恢复下载过程,并在完成后将文件保存至设备上的特定目录。
3. **权限管理**:为了访问网络和存储,在Android系统中应用需获取相应权限。使用E4A开发的应用应在manifest.xml文件中声明这些必要的权限。
4. **版本比较**:应用需要判断本地版本与服务器上最新版之间的差异,这通常通过对比软件的主次修订号来实现。
5. **安装更新**:下载完新版本后,需替换旧应用程序。对于APK格式的应用程序更新包,则调用系统自带的安装程序完成这一过程。
6. **用户提示和交互设计**:在自动更新过程中提供适当的反馈给用户是必要的,比如展示进度条、请求立即启动更新等操作。E4A提供了丰富的UI控件与事件处理机制来帮助开发者创建友好界面并管理好用户体验。
7. **异常情况处理**:为确保应用能在网络不稳定或存储空间不足的情况下正常运行,编写相应的错误处理代码至关重要。
8. **教程内容概览**:通常会涵盖如何导入自动更新类库、设置何时检查新版本(如启动时或者联网时)、实现下载及安装逻辑等内容,并指导开发者调试和优化整个流程。
此外,“E4A界面非常漂亮好看的自动更新类库+教程”还将涉及使用该工具创建美观用户界面上的技巧,包括布局设计、颜色搭配以及图标选择等细节。同时提供详细的使用方法与示例代码帮助快速理解和集成这一功能到自己的应用中。
通过学习这个自动更新类库及其配套教程,开发者不仅能掌握实现自动更新的技术要点,还能了解如何在E4A环境中打造具有吸引力的用户界面以提高产品的竞争力和用户体验度。
全部评论 (0)


